What are loads in construction?

A structural load or structural action is a force, deformation, or acceleration applied to structural elements. A load causes stress, deformation, and displacement in a structure. Excess load may cause structural failure, so this should be considered and controlled during the design of a structure.

What are the 3 loads?

The types of loads that act on building structures and other structures can be broadly classified as vertical, horizontal, and longitudinal loads. Vertical loads consist of dead loads, live loads, and impact loads. Horizontal loads consist of wind loads and earthquakes.

How many types of loadings are there?

There are five fundamental loading conditions; tension, compression, bending, shear, and torsion. Tension is the type of loading in which the two sections of material on either side of a plane tend to be pulled apart or elongated.
